The battery itself is made up of 6.5 kWh battery modules that are stored in a larger cabinet-like enclosure called the ESS. The battery enclosure also contains the inverter, which converts DC electricity generated by your solar panels into AC electricity that you can use to power your home. Raindrop Electricity: Turning Precipitation into Power

An inventive way to guarantee a consistent and dependable power supply is to combine the energy output from raindrops with other renewable energy sources, such as solar panels. These hybrid systems have the benefit of using power produced by raindrops when it rains and effortlessly transitioning to alternate sources like solar when it''s dry.

How To Store Electricity From Solar Panels – Storables

It allows excess electricity generated by solar panels to be stored for later use, ensuring a continuous and reliable power supply. Several methods are used to store electricity, including batteries, pumped hydro storage, and thermal energy storage. Collecting energy from raindrops using solar panel technology

To collect raindrop energy, a device called a triboelectric nanogenerator (TENG), which uses liquid-solid contact electrification, has been shown to successfully harvest the electricity from raindrops.

Can raindrops be used to collect energy?

The idea is already in practical applications like hydroelectric dams and wave power collection systems, where the movement of the water generates electricity. However, the efforts to collect energy from falling raindrops have faced a technical hurdle that has made the concept inefficient and impractical.

Is raindrop energy transient?

Since it is reliant on rainfall, raindrop energy is transient. A significant difficulty is effectively storing and dispersing this energy. In order to retain surplus energy during rainy seasons and release it when needed, battery technology and energy management systems must be upgraded.
